When selecting a compact smartwatch band that works across different models, start with compatibility as the core criterion. Look for bands designed to support standard lug widths and adaptable attachment mechanisms, such as spring bars or quick-release pins that align with widely used sizes. Consider the range of devices you own now or may own soon, and verify that the band’s connectors match those interfaces. The best options provide a secure fit without pinching the skin, while remaining easy to remove and reattach with one hand. Material choices influence feel, breathability, and longevity, so balance softness against resilience to daily abrasion.
Beyond universal fit, comfort remains paramount for sustained wear. Evaluate how the band sits on the wrist, including its thickness and curvature that trace the contours of your skin. For long sessions, a low-profile design reduces bulk under cuffs and sleeves. Look for edges that are softly rounded to prevent chafing, and check whether the band minimizes sweat buildup through breathable textures or perforations. A good compact band should adapt to different climates and activities, from gym workouts to office meetings, without heat buildup or irritation. Consider the inner surface’s texture and finish, because this directly affects wearability over hours.

Durability hinges on material science and engineering choices that withstand daily use. High-grade silicone, fluoroelastomer, or woven fibers provide varying degrees of resilience, tackiness, and moisture management. When a band resists stretching, cracking, or color fading, it preserves both appearance and function over months. Reinforcements near the attachment points reduce wear from repeated bending and twisting. For models exposed to water or sweat, choose water-resistant coatings and colorfast dyes that won’t bleed. The best designs feature reinforced lugs or end caps that prevent deformation around the pins, ensuring a dependable grip even after rough handling or sudden movements.

Swapping should be straightforward yet secure. A reputable compact band uses quick-release spring bars or similar mechanisms that require minimal tools, yet hold firmly in place during vigorous activity. Test how easily you can swap bands without removing the watch or disturbing its seated position. When possible, pick sets that include two or more bands with different textures to suit varying outfits and environments. Aims to minimize risk of accidental detachment when pulling the band through the lugs. Reading user reviews about real-world swap experiences helps separate marketing claims from practical performance, especially for travelers who rely on replacements on the go.

Texture choices profoundly affect comfort, moisture management, and long-term wearability. Perforated or mesh designs support airflow, helping to keep skin dry in hot weather or during intense activity. Smooth, matte finishes feel gentle against the skin, reducing resistance that can cause redness after extended wear. The choice between synthetic fibers and natural equivalents often comes down to allergen concerns and environmental sensitivity. A compact band should balance softness with structural integrity, so it doesn’t lose shape or sag over time. If you wear a watch daily, select a texture that remains comfortable after repeated washing and exposure to sunscreen or lotion.
Breathability translates into practical health benefits, especially for people with sensitive skin or acne-prone areas. Well-ventilated bands reduce sweat accumulation beneath the watch, lowering the likelihood of irritation. Some designs incorporate airflow channels or micro-gaps that facilitate evaporation without compromising support. The inner liner should feel gentle and low-friction, preventing friction burns that can occur during long walks or runs. For those with perspiration issues, consider moisture-wicking layers that pull moisture away from the skin. The best bands maintain comfort while preserving staple features like durability and cross-model compatibility.

Travel-friendly bands excel at packing light while offering dependable performance. A compact design travels easily in a small pouch, with quick swaps that suit changing outfits or time zones. When choosing, assess whether the band ships with a small tool kit or replacements that fit in a pocket. A key attribute is consistency across brands; you don’t want to hunt for a tool or adapter in a foreign country. Material choices should tolerate varied climates, from humid jungles to dry airports, with minimal expansion, shrinking, or discoloration under different temperatures.
Maintenance matters for longevity and aesthetics. Cleanability is critical: bands should resist staining, and any cleansing method must not degrade the adhesive or color. Silicone and fluoroelastomer bands tolerate soap and water, while woven fabrics may require gentle washing and air drying. Avoid harsh chemicals that can degrade protective coatings. For white or light-tone bands, consider a finish that minimizes visible wear and reveals the watch’s overall elegance rather than showing scuffs. Regular inspection of lugs, bars, and connectors helps detect wear before it becomes a source of insecurity or failure.
When comparing options, map your real-world routines onto the band’s features. If you commute daily, you’ll appreciate quick swaps, secure closures, and a low-profile fit under cuffs. For workouts, prioritize moisture management, grip, and durability in aggressive environments. For social events, elegance and discretion may favor a sleeker profile and refined textures. Evaluate warranty terms and customer service quality, as a flexible return policy makes it easier to experiment with models and sizes. A bundle that includes multiple bands with complementary textures can deliver the most versatility and extend the life of your initial investment.
